Two suspects were taken into custody following a high speed chase that crossed county lines into St. Joseph, Mo.
According to KQ2, officers initially received a domestic disturbance call from the National Guard Armory. Officers witnessed a male assaulting a woman.
The man forced the woman into the vehicle, which fled after law enforcement attempted to stop the vehicle.
Speeds esculated between 80-90 miles per hour. The chase concluded on St. Joseph Ave near the Burger King.
Law enforcement officials say during the chase, two individuals inside the vehicle switched seats. The female was discovered behind the wheel when the chase concluded.
Both individuals were taken into custody.
The St. Joseph Police Department and Missouri State Highway Patrol were assisted by several agencies in the chase.
